At the end of the course, the student-teacher will be able to:

  1. Develop English language teaching competency.

  2. Equip themselves with skills to meet challenges in the teaching and learning process.

  3. Acquire good pronunciation for communication approaching native-speaker level.

  4. Understand and appreciate the importance of English.

  5. Expand their vocabulary for listening, reading, speaking, and writing.

  6. Understand the importance of evaluating students’ achievement in English language.

  7. Speak English fluently and accurately.

  8. Identify the relationship between the syllabus, textbook, and curriculum.
